Built circa 1832 by John Luce, the property has seen its fair share of stories, even if none has been filmed for a Hollywood production. From the simple elegance of the front porch's stone steps with IONIC COLUMNS, and cut lead crystal door, to the GLASS-ENCLOSED SUNROOM overlooking the large outside deck and the gardens below, this is a special home. Featuring HARDWOOD FLOORS throughout, 7 BEDROOMS, 4 FIREPLACES and 3.25 BATHS on the first 2 floors, and multiple rooms and potential bath on the 3rd floor, the home would be ideal as a B&B, or artist retreat. Or simply use it as an expansive family home where everyone has a room of their own and extra ones for pursuing crafts and personal passions, as well as entertaining. Speaking of entertaining, the elegant dining room, with easy access to the large BUTLER PANTRY with original BUILT-IN CABINETS, and the gorgeous sunroom and connecting deck, provide more than ample space to host friends, family and guests. Elegant QUARTER-ROUND windows, period-STENCILED FLOORS, original light fixtures and pristine woodwork are just some of the many details you'll adore. The LARGE BACKYARD bordered by MATURE PERENNIAL GARDENS adds to the versatility of the home with its large CARRIAGE HOUSE, raised stone terrace, and COTTAGE, perfect for an outdoor bar, or food service space.
